This is one of the most versatile spokes in the DT Swiss spoke range. DT competition gets its special strength from cold forging. This makes an extremely durable spoke and thanks to the thinner middle section, it is 48 g lighter (per 64 spokes) than a spoke with a constant diameter of 1.8 mm. It is perfect for a wide range of uses, from road wheels to super light enduro MTB wheels. - Double Butted: 2.0/1.8/2.0 - One 264mm spoke = 6g - Nipples sold separately

Package comes with two pieces of rim tape for use with the Zipp clinchers. Woven nylon material. Tape is extra thin with a thickness of 0.5 mm. Note: For Zipp 700c and 650c aluminum/carbon hybrid clichers, use the 16 mm rim tape. For Zipp 30 wheel set use 18mm but for the wider Firecrest and Firestrike carbon clinchers use the 20mm x 1/2mm rim tape.

Surly Rim Strips have one job and they do it well. They cover the cutouts in your rim and — if you're running a tube — they protect it from spoke heads and other sharp matter (okay, so maybe they have TWO jobs but they do them both really well.) Rim strips are crucial and should be used with all Surly rims. Ours come in an array of colors so you can really "express yourself." Surly Rim strips are available in two different materials: PVC and Nylon. PVC is great if you plan on only running tubes. However, if there's any part of you that wants to try this tubeless thing you've been hearing about, Nylon strips are just the ticket. They're thinner and offer minimal stretch so they stay put and lay nicely inside the rim to provide a secure seal. Plus, they're lighter which we all know means you'll go faster… maybe.
